I would please like to know how would i go about adjusting the level of my headlights on a ED6 Civic.

look closely at your head light from inside the engine bay. you will se a spiked metal round thing where you can stick your phillips head screw driver in and turn, each head light will have 2 , one for Horizontal and one for vertical adjustment. what you should do is park a known good car 5 to 10 meters from a wall, use chalk and maek the ground of the position of the front bumper on the ground and the center of the front of the car, turn on the low beems and mark the wall of there posiotion.

now place your car in the same location and adjust your head lights the same. try to use a similar car in hight as your as a reffernce.

Make sure you dont get the vertical and horizontal one mixed up. I just adjusted my lights yesterday and I accidently mistaken them. I keeped on turning and the light wouldnt move up but i could see it moving and i didn't noe wth was goin on. -_-. Had a pain in the arse time readjusting it back to centre. If the civic same as type r one, the far bolt in the corner makes it go left and right and the one closer to the middle is up and down.
